The LC4256B-75F256AI is a Complex Programmable Logic Device (CPLD) from Lattice Semiconductor. It features 16 Logic Blocks (LABs), 256 macrocells, and operates at a maximum frequency of 322MHz. The device is packaged in a Ball Grid Array (BGA) and is suitable for surface mount applications. It can operate over a temperature range of -40°C to 105°C, with a supply voltage of 2.3V to 2.7V and an operating supply current of 12.5mA.
